It was like he was never not here, and he is the spit of DH even in DH baby pictures they could be mistaken for each other!!LO has been here 9 months now, we have legally adopted him and are starting to see changes as he really settles into life with us. Just recently on play dates he stopped going to people's front doors and crying, something that I knew was about the move but couldn't work out how to reassure him that I wasn't going to leave him there, only to keep doing it until he knew he would always be coming home again with me. Now he wanders off to investigate the other children's toys like any other child would after the initial shyness of course. He has started sleeping through the night, although about an hour after going to bed he shouts for us, we go up and lie him back down and he sleeps through then - we think he just needs to know we are there if he calls.
